Opening a Sportsbook


A sportsbook is a gambling establishment that accepts wagers on different sports events. In addition to placing bets on individual teams, a sportsbook also offers prop bets, which are wagers on specific aspects of a game. Prop bets can range from the number of points scored in a game to whether a team will win a particular championship. Some bettors even place futures bets, which are bets on the outcome of a championship in years to come. These bets are often based on statistical information and analysis of current trends. In order to make money, a sportsbook must have good odds and spreads. Winning bets are paid when the event finishes, or if it is not finished, when it has been played long enough to become official. However, winning bets are not paid if the event is not official or if it does not take place in accordance with rules of the sport.

The most important thing to remember when opening a sportsbook is that you need to be licensed. Depending on where you live, there are different laws and regulations regarding sports betting. You should also make sure that your sportsbook is secure and that you use a trusted payment gateway to process payments.

In addition to this, you need to make sure that your sportsbook is scalable and has all the features necessary to attract and retain users. One way to do this is by offering rewards, which can be a great incentive for users to keep using your product. You can also incorporate a filtering feature in your sportsbook to help users find the results they are interested in. This will ensure that your users have a positive experience with your sportsbook.

Another mistake that many sportsbooks make is not having a wide variety of betting options. This can lead to bettors losing money because they are not able to find the bets that they want. It is also a good idea to shop around for the best lines, as different sportsbooks will set their odds differently. For example, the Chicago Cubs may be -180 at one sportsbook, but they might be -190 at another. This might not sound like a big deal, but it can add up over time.

In addition, some sportsbooks require a large amount of money upfront to accept bets. This can be a problem for some people, especially those who are not able to afford this type of deposit. To avoid this, you should consider working with a pay-per-head bookie. This type of software will allow you to pay only for the players that you are actively working with, which is far less expensive than paying a flat fee. It is also a lot more flexible than other types of payments, which can be a huge benefit during the busy season. This method can also be a great way to keep your sportsbook profitable throughout the year. This is particularly important because the volume of betting on some sports varies throughout the year.